If a heat lamp using a medium-base lamp holder is installed in a residential bathroom, does it have to be on a separate heating branch circuit?
No; CEC Rule 62-108(3)
What size conductor would you need to supply a 3kW baseboard heater fed by a 240V circuit?
AWG #12. The calculated load requires a 20A overcorrect device. Therefore, the wire size must be increased from #14 AWG
What is the maximum setting of overcorrect device allowed to protect branch circuit wiring supplying two or more residential baseboard heaters?
30A; CEC Rule 62-114(2)
Is it necessary that a thermostat with a marked OFF position disconnect all ungrounded conductors in the circuit?
Yes; CEC Rule 62-118(2)
Why is it not permissible to shorten the heating portion of a series heating cable set?
The series resistance would be reduced, resulting in increased current and possible overheating (fire hazard); CEC Rule 62-122(1)
Indoor heating cable sets that are to be embedded in concrete shall beat the designation Type _______
1B; CEC Rule 62-124(1) and Table 60
Where are the supply registers of a forced-air furnace normally located?
Around the perimeter of each room, preferably in front of areas of high heat loss
What is the purpose of the heat exchanger in a gas-fired furnace?
To separate the products of combustion from the circulated air
The typical efficiency of a gas-fired furnace is between ___% and ___%
70%, 80%
How many conductors are commonly needed between the furnace and the room thermostat? What is the magnitude of the voltage that they carry?
Two or three; 24V
Which does the room thermostat control directly, the gas valve or the blower motor?
The gas valve
After the thermostat contacts open, which shuts off first, the blower motor or the gas burner?
The gas burner
What is the purpose of the anticipator resistor in the room thermostat?
To limit the set-point overshoot to an acceptable level
What is the purpose of the thermocouple? Is one always necessary?
When heated, the thermocouple generates a small current that holds the gas safety valve open. A thermocouple is not required on units equipped with electronic spark ignition
List two conditions that may cause overheating of the heat exchanger
- Room thermostat contacts stuck closed
- Blower does not run
- Insufficient air flow
What prevents the heat exchanger from overheating?
The high limit overheat safety thermostat will close the main gas valve
What are the typical settings for the blower control/overheat safety thermostat?
- Blower OFF at 32°C (90°F)
- Blower ON at 54°C (130°F)
- High limit OFF at 104°C (220°F)
Where should an electronic air cleaner be installed on a furnace?
In the return air duct, preferably downstream of the standard filter
Describe how an electronic air cleaner filters the air
The ionizing section charges the dust particles which are then attracted to the charged collection plates
Why should the electronic air cleaner be interlocked with the blower motor?
To prevent the accumulation of ozone that can occur if the cleaner is energized and has no air flowing through it
